Product-led growth (PLG) entails optimizing your product so that it can generate self-service sales, provide consumers with rapid value, and persuade them to switch from being freemium or trial users to paying customers. To be successful, your PLG technology stack must make it simple to collect quantitative and qualitative product usage data so that you and your teams are always aware of what’s happening with the product and where the best growth possibilities are. Why do you need product-led growth tools?

Getting individuals to test your product is insufficient. After they have signed up, you must ensure that they have a positive user experience and recognize the value of your product. You may be wondering, “Why do I even need a product-led growth tool?”

There are a few scenarios in which you might require one:

  • Product-led growth tools let businesses create automated in-app tutorials like welcome screens, checklists, and tooltips without wasting your developer’s time on specialized coding.
  • PLG tools offer product usage metrics that enable you to identify the consumers that require assistance and when.
  • PLG tools allow businesses to target in-app experiences more precisely with segmentation (something that would be impossible to achieve if all in-app instructions had to be coded by hand).
  • PLG tools enable businesses to automate the process of implementing and A/B testing multiple product-led strategies faster.

Must-have characteristics of product-led growth tools

Prior to settling on a product-led growth tool, it’s important to bear in mind a standard set of capabilities that should be present in every viable option. If not, you won’t be able to effectively create in-app guides, product tours, and more that assist businesses in creating effective users experience value.

Consider these criteria when selecting a product-led growth tool:

Setup clear objective

Start by establishing specific objectives. What do you hope to accomplish with each tool? Each product should contribute in some way to the PLG strategy. If it is not part of your strategy, you are employing it for the sake of it.

User interface

Ensure that the tool you use does not restrict access to fundamental UI patterns and guidelines on the beginner plans. Checklists, modal design, tooltips, banners, and hotspots are the most significant for executing a product-driven strategy.

Collaborate on common tools

It’s easy to slip into the trap of having separate teams use different tools. Whether teams work in silos or you haven’t looked at a tool’s features, it’s easy to end up paying for more than one tool that does the same thing. Stop overcomplicating your company processes. Bring together all teams to determine the most effective tools for everyone.

Balanced tool stack

You should be able to maintain a balanced tool stack over the entire lifecycle. You shouldn’t employ too many tools during the onboarding phase and forget about engagement or conversion. Ensure that the tools you use facilitate both your work and the user experience for your consumers.

Customer Segmentation

Consider acquiring segmentation capabilities based on in-app behavior and interaction with in-app experiences so that you can customize your messaging for each segment.

Niche tool usage

If you’re serious about scaling your SaaS business with your PLG approach, you should employ niche tools. If you’re just getting started, all-in-one tools can be useful, but they don’t necessarily give the same degree of experience and functionality in every area that you focus on. Even better, seek technologies designed specifically for SaaS enterprises. There are a variety of features available on SaaS-focused applications that can make your work more effective.

Advanced analytics

Adequate analytics will be helpful. Look for a tool that gives you at least basic capabilities to gather and evaluate the feedback and that enables you to track how users progress through the user journey and interact with the product’s features.

Integration capabilities

The ideal tool should be able to integrate with other tools in your stack, allowing you to gain superior insights into your data in a single location.

Pendo

Pendo is a product experience platform that helps various software teams determine to track how often customers are using or interacting with various features and software components. Insights like this can be used to tailor in-app tutorials, notifications, and walkthroughs to each individual user’s needs. Customers’ web and mobile app behavior can be analyzed with the use of Pendo’s platform data.

Businesses can benefit from Pendo’s behavioral analytics platform by extracting and analyzing information like time spent, trends over time, and drop-off points. By having this information on hand, businesses will be better able to tailor their content to the needs of a certain audience and make adjustments in light of the findings. Pendo gives tools to send feedback surveys and polls, allowing businesses to gather both qualitative and quantitative data to learn where their customers are experiencing issues so they can fix them.

Mixpanel

Mixpanel is a well-known product analytics tool that can help you with your PLG approach. Mixpanel is a freemium product analytics software for monitoring mobile and web application performance. Its interactive reports assist you in gaining a better understanding of your users and how they utilize your product, hence increasing your engagement, conversion, and retention rates.

Mixpanel helps businesses keep track of important quantitative data such as LTV (customer lifetime value) and churn rate, analyze user click activity across the product to determine what is being overlooked, create funnels to show how free users become premium users, segment data to identify retention drivers and more.

Chartmogul

ChartMogul is a subscription analytics tool that enables you to track, comprehend, and expand your revenue. It facilitates data-driven decision-making by automating the reporting of critical SaaS KPIs such as monthly recurring revenue, annual recurring revenue, churn rate, and lifetime value. Its integration capabilities with your existing technology and data stack can facilitate data management and analysis easier. ChartMogul can Segment data to identify user profiles and price options that are likely to result in conversions.

Segment

Segment is a prominent customer data platform that collects events from websites and mobile applications in order to help you manage and analyze customer data. By consolidating customer data across channels and devices into a unified profile and by providing insights into product performance through A/B testing, this tool helps businesses better serve their clientele. Customer interactions can be tailored to each individual and occur in real-time; the code is well-organized and simple to use.
